The 'Vibe' Check: Who Thrives Here?
Morrisville is characterized by its high educational attainment, with 73.3% of residents holding at least a bachelor's degree and a low poverty rate of 5.2%. The community has a significant number of renters at 55.7%, reflecting a competitive housing market with a median gross rent of $1,760.
Probably not your spot if you are looking for extensive public transit options, as only 0.1% of the population commutes via public transport.
Your Money: Housing & Cost Snapshot
- Median gross rent is $1,760, indicating a competitive rental market.
- The median owner-occupied home value is $466,900, suggesting higher home buying costs.
- 73.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, contributing to a well-educated community.
- The poverty rate is low at 5.2%, reflecting overall economic stability.
Source: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-Year Data Profiles.
Crime & Safety: What the Numbers Say
North Carolina's crime rates indicate some positive trends, with overall violent crime decreasing by 21.5% from 2022 to 2025. The state annual violent crime rate is 321 per 100,000, slightly below the national average. Property crime has also declined by 15.1% over the same period.
- Violent crime rate: 321 per 100,000 vs. national rate of 325.3.
- Property crime rate: 1,780.6 per 100,000 vs. national rate of 1,546.9.
- Notable trend: Homicide rate down 23.2% since 2022.
Source: FBI Crime Data Explorer (state-level summarized data for North Carolina).

Weather & Getting Outside
Wake County sees about 33.9 inches of precipitation annually, spread over approximately 98 rainy days, which means you'll want to keep an umbrella handy. The area experiences minimal snowfall, averaging about 0.3 inches per year.
